Transaction 7683cd6880153fe75875e72efc342806faad2e9cc4ef9e8e8e3304bab86a4791
1 Input
1 Output
-
7683cd6880153fe75875e72efc342806faad2e9cc4ef9e8e8e3304bab86a4791:0
- value
- 605739
- script pubkey
- OP_0 OP_PUSHBYTES_20 0724f76d8eb3b9cc01b32e18872b276406a4db36
- address
- bc1qquj0wmvwkwuucqdn9cvgw2e8vsr2fkeka25nqz